As far as your diet goes... that's what I did & am doing now! I get most all my carbs from 'veggies' & some fruits and "full grained" pasta's or breads when I do have them. It really does work. If you are working out you need carbs... so just make them full grained. I am following the South Beach (Diet) Program(don't like calling it a diet - it's a life style change to me)... I did the first phase & got thru it, but didn't feel well (He called it a cleansing period); then when I got to phase II, where the Dr. brings in the full grained carbs & some fruit I began to feel better... so that's the phase I will stay in till I get this wt. off. Phase III brings in many more carbs then II does, but I want to stay low right now till I lose at least 50lbs. The best part about the diet is that he believes in low-fat (not all the high fats like Atkins) and brings in full grained carbs. Just watch your portions when it comes to the carbs and drink plenty of water & you will do great. I have been losing wt. even though I have a treat on Sunday's with Joe, just a little slower.
